His music has made its way into almost every major dubstep artists’ set as of late as well as made appearances at huge festivals around the globe. After several releases on some of the biggest labels in the game, including Circus Records, Firepower Records, and Never Say Die, Kompany is back with a brand new EP, New Reign. Check it out below.
Released via Never Say Die, New Reign slaps hard with its fast-paced energy and meticulously crafted sound design. The four-track EP kicks off in full force with “Rapture,” which builds from a tranquil intro into a guttural bass masterpiece. Next comes the trippy tune “Override,” showing Kompany’s experimental side. “Stomp” is literally what it sounds like, with its crunchy bass jabs and heavy-hitting chaos. He wraps it up nicely with “Buck,” a juggernaut of a track with a haunting orchestral outro.
We can’t wait to see what Kompany and Never Say Die have planned for the rest of the year. Until then, we’ll keep breaking our neck to these four bangers.
